Chronic conditions can affect seniors significantly. Here are tips for effective management and improved wellness.
Stay up-to-date with doctor visits to effectively manage chronic conditions.
Educate yourself about your condition to better manage symptoms and treatment plans.
Establish a routine for medications, meals, and physical activity to promote stability.
A balanced diet tailored to your condition can significantly improve your quality of life.
Find support groups for individuals with similar conditions to share experiences and advice.
Keep track of symptoms to identify triggers and discuss them with your healthcare provider.
Physical activity is essential for managing many chronic conditions. Find activities you enjoy.
Chronic conditions can take an emotional toll. Practice mindfulness and seek support when needed.
Keep lines of communication open with caregivers and family members about your health needs.
Be proactive about your health care decisions and advocate for necessary changes in your treatment plan.
